During perimenopause and menopause, fluctuating and declining estrogen levels trigger a cascade of symptoms that go far beyond hot flashes. You might experience night sweats that drench your sheets, sleep disruption that leaves you exhausted, anxiety that feels out of proportion, brain fog that makes you feel like you’re losing your mind, joint pain that wasn’t there before, and changes in muscle mass that frustrate you even when you’re working out. The psychological toll is significant too—perimenopausal women have about a 40% higher risk of developing depressive symptoms or receiving a depression diagnosis than premenopausal women. These aren’t minor inconveniences you should just tough out. They’re profound physiological events, and they respond well to targeted nutritional intervention when you choose the right ingredients and use them correctly.
Perimenopause is the transitional phase leading up to menopause, typically beginning in a woman’s 40s. This phase can last anywhere from 4 to 10 years—yes, a full decade—during which estrogen and progesterone levels fluctuate wildly before their final decline. A well-designed hormone supplement combination can address multiple symptom pathways simultaneously—the vasomotor symptoms (hot flashes), cognitive issues (brain fog), musculoskeletal problems (joint pain), and mood changes (anxiety, depression). Skipping labs entirely: Many women self-diagnose deficiencies based on how they feel and end up over-supplementing with fat-soluble vitamins like D and A, which can accumulate in your body to toxic levels. To prevent this, avoid excessive doses of fat-soluble vitamins (A, E, K) and be skeptical of supplements that make unsubstantiated hormone-balancing claims without evidence backing them up.
Relying on serum magnesium alone: Here’s the thing: a standard serum magnesium test is a poor indicator of your body’s true magnesium status because most magnesium is stored inside your cells, not circulating in your blood. For a more accurate picture, request an RBC (red blood cell) magnesium test. Magnesium is involved in over 300 enzymatic reactions, including those that regulate sleep, mood, and stress. Clinical data shows that magnesium deficiency is common in perimenopausal women and is associated with worse sleep quality, increased anxiety, and more severe hot flashes. How to Do It
- Magnesium Glycinate or Bisglycinate (300-400 mg): These chelated forms of magnesium are highly bioavailable and gentle on your digestive system—unlike magnesium oxide, which can cause cramping and loose stools. Clinical evidence shows that taking 300-400 mg of magnesium glycinate or bisglycinate in the evening supports sleep onset, reduces anxiety, and may ease hot flash intensity. Many women notice better sleep within just 1-2 weeks.
- Vitamin D3 + K2: These two vitamins work as a team for bone health. As a fat-soluble vitamin, D3 helps your body absorb calcium, while K2 directs that calcium to your bones and away from arteries, where it could cause unwanted calcification. Target a daily dose of 2,000-4,000 IU of D3 based on your lab results, always taken with a meal containing fat to maximize absorption. Without K2, you’re only getting half the benefit.
- Omega-3 Fatty Acids (EPA/DHA, 2-3 g daily): Omega-3s are essential fats that are naturally anti-inflammatory and support cardiovascular health, brain function, and mood. A recent systematic review suggests that omega-3 fish oil supplements can reduce depressive symptoms and show benefits for mood and cognition after menopause, especially since low dietary intake is associated with higher rates of depression in postmenopausal women. Take your dose with your largest meal of the day to enhance absorption.
- B-Complex with Active Forms: B vitamins, including B6, B12, folate, and riboflavin, are crucial for nervous system function. Studies have shown they support cognition, lower the risk of depression, and even help with bone density while reducing hot flashes. For optimal absorption, look for a B-complex that contains methylated forms, such as methylcobalamin (B12) and methylfolate (B9), which your body can use immediately without additional conversion steps.

How to Do It
- Ashwagandha (Withania somnifera, 300-600 mg KSM-66 extract): This powerful adaptogen has been shown in clinical settings to reduce perimenopausal symptoms like hot flashes and insomnia. Multiple randomized controlled trials confirm that ashwagandha reduces the stress hormone cortisol, improves sleep quality, and lessens anxiety. It’s best taken in the evening, and you’ll likely notice effects within 3-4 weeks of consistent use.
- Shatavari (Asparagus racemosus, 300 mg standardized extract): Shatavari is a renowned adaptogenic herb in Ayurvedic medicine, a traditional system of medicine from India. Known as the “Queen of Herbs,” it’s traditionally used for female reproductive health and hormonal balance. A recent clinical trial demonstrated that daily supplementation with 250 mg of Shatavari extract significantly reduced a range of menopausal symptoms, including hot flashes, vaginal dryness, and mood instability, with no adverse effects reported.
- Maca Root (1,500-3,000 mg): For symptoms like low libido, adaptogenic herbs such as maca root may be beneficial. Some clinical evidence also suggests that ginseng may improve overall energy, quality of life, and sexual desire in menopausal women. Maca is generally well tolerated and can be taken in the morning, often mixed into a smoothie for easier consumption.
- Phytoestrogens (Soy Isoflavones or Red Clover, 40-80 mg): Phytoestrogens are plant-derived compounds that exert a weak estrogen-like effect in your body. An analysis of over 40 systematic reviews shows that phytoestrogens from soy isoflavones or red clover reduce hot flash frequency by approximately one additional flash per day compared to placebo across 15 different randomized controlled trials. This option is most appropriate for women whose primary complaint is vasomotor symptoms—meaning hot flashes and night sweats.
- Creatine Monohydrate (3-5 g daily): Often associated with athletes, creatine is incredibly beneficial for perimenopausal women, and this surprises many people. Research shows that a daily dose of 3-5 grams of creatine supports muscle maintenance, bone density, and cognitive function in women over 40, who have 70-80% lower creatine stores than men. Growing evidence also suggests it may support memory, focus, and mood during periods of hormonal fluctuation, making it a smart addition to your stack.

How to Do It
- Morning with breakfast (or first meal): This is the best time for energizing supplements and those that require fat for absorption. Your morning dose should include omega-3 fatty acids, vitamin D3 + K2, your B-complex, maca root, and creatine. Taking these with food ensures better absorption and fewer digestive issues.
- Evening with a light snack: This window is ideal for calming nutrients that support sleep and relaxation. Your evening dose should include magnesium glycinate, ashwagandha, and shatavari, typically taken 30-60 minutes before bed. A small snack helps with absorption and keeps your stomach settled.
- Manage mineral conflicts: Here’s something most people don’t realize: certain minerals compete for the same absorption pathways in your gut. Clinical studies show that high-dose zinc and magnesium compete for the same gut transporters, so taking them at the same time reduces the absorption of both. Similarly, iron and calcium can compete for absorption. If you take an iron supplement, take it at a different time than calcium, and pair it with Vitamin C to enhance its absorption.

Why Traditional Iron Pills Cause Constipation
The science of supplement-induced constipation is straightforward. When you take a high-dose inorganic iron pill like ferrous sulfate, your body can only absorb a small fraction. The remaining unabsorbed iron lingers in the gut, where it acts as a pro-oxidant. This reactive iron feeds “bad” bacteria and pathogens, disrupting your delicate microbiome and causing significant inflammation. This leads to a frustrating “Dose vs. Absorption” myth. Many believe a higher milligram count equals better results, but a massive dose of poorly absorbed iron only increases your distress. The Science of Gentle Iron: Understanding Chelation and Bioavailability
Choosing the best iron supplement for women without constipation requires a shift from quantity to quality. Traditional iron supplements often use inorganic salts like ferrous sulfate. These molecules are unstable in the digestive tract. They break apart quickly, leaving raw iron to irritate your stomach lining. In contrast, organic chelated iron is chemically bonded to amino acids. This process, known as chelation, creates a stable structure that stays intact until it reaches the optimal site for absorption in your body.
Iron bisglycinate is the gold standard of this technology. It features an iron atom safely cradled between two glycine molecules. These amino acids act as a protective buffer, preventing the iron from reacting with your gut tissue. This “Trojan Horse” effect allows the iron to pass through the stomach unnoticed. It effectively bypasses common absorption blockers like the phytates in your morning oats or the tannins in your afternoon tea. Clinical studies consistently show that iron bisglycinate has a bioavailability roughly 2 to 4 times higher than ferrous sulfate, even when taken at lower doses.

Timing your intake is just as vital as the form of iron you choose. Tea, coffee, and calcium are known “blockers” that can reduce iron absorption by up to 60% if taken simultaneously. To ensure zero gastric distress and maximum uptake, aim to take your iron at least two hours away from these substances. Many women find the ideal window is mid-morning or mid-afternoon, between meals. This allows the chelated molecules to glide through your system without competing for pathways or being bound by tannins.
